I doubt much has changed over the years, but this is the current plan for the Menagerie.
 
I see that is almost identical than for my 2009 visit, except that the area of tapirs and muntjacks (extreme right) had ostriches then (I don't remember if dromedaries too). The yellow-throated marten enclosure had then capercaillies, and the binturong was Great Curassow, if I situate the things correctly. Visayan warty pigs were absent from the collection by 2009, as also were the bustards (their enclosures occuped by some pheasants and owls, including Himalayan Monal and Northern hawk owl) and the quoll (it's enclosure was occupied by guira cuckoos). All enclosures seems to be the same now than then.
